Sammy Watkins ruled OUT for Chiefs-Broncos on TNF

The Chiefs ruled out wide receiver Sammy Watkins for Week 7 Thursday Night Football due to his hamstring injury. We break down the fantasy football implicationsl.

The Kansas City Chiefs announced their final injury report for Week 7 Thursday Night Football against the Denver Broncos, and they will be without wide receiver Sammy Watkins. The Chiefs officially ruled him out after three days of limited in practice.

Watkins injured his hamstring in the first quarter of the Chiefs Week 5 matchup with the Colts. He did not practice in Week 6 and was listed as doubtful for that game against the Texans.

Fantasy football analysis, Chiefs WR Sammy Watkins

The Chiefs welcomed back Tyreek Hill last week and he was their leading receiver with 80 yards against Houston. Mecole Hardman had four receptions for 45 yards and Byron Pringle had two receptions for 24 yards. Demarcus Robinson was targeted four times but failed to catch a pass.

It’s a toss-up which of the three receivers will emerge behind Hill. And if the Broncos defense gives the Chiefs trouble, it might be none of them. Hill and tight end Travis Kelce are must-starts in traditional fantasy leagues. After that, you have to judge your own depth. Robinson has more targets than Hardman and Pringle, but Hardman has been the most consistent week over week. I’d probably rank them Hardman, Robinson, Pringle.
